Caregivers need care too!
As Caregivers, we tend to focus more on the family member we are caring for, and most times forget ourselves during this time. It is hard to focus on your health and well-being when you are taking care of your loved one; your end goal is to ensure they get healthy and back to living life as normal as possible. We wake up early, make sure they are fed, bathed and dressed; as well as if there are appointments ensuring that they are at all appointments. It is a daunting task to be the one to take care of the personal matters of your loved one, but the question remains, "Who else will do it?" Being a caretaker brings on a different type of stress that can wear you down and cause major burnout. One should never be ashamed to ask for assistance from other family members, especially those that are in the same state as you.
